Disability Ramp Repair Questions
What types of disability ramp repairs are common? Repairs often include fixing loose or damaged handrails, replacing worn-out surface materials, and repairing structural components to ensure safety and stability.
How can I tell if my ramp needs repair? Signs include wobbling, cracks, missing or broken parts, or difficulty in use due to surface deterioration.
Are there specific materials used for ramp repairs? Common materials include pressure-treated wood, aluminum, and non-slip surface coatings to enhance durability and safety.
What projects are typically requested for ramp repairs? Projects often involve restoring existing ramps, upgrading surfaces for better traction, or replacing sections to meet accessibility needs.
